@Adenahmadi: it's not that clear cut
First, Unwieldy uses "Single action" which technically means nothing (action are either Simple, Basic or Double).
Then, consider the wording for Suspensors (GotU p137): "An Unwieldy weapon fitted with suspensors is far more manoeuvrable. Firing it becomes a Basic action rather than a Double action." This implies that Unwieldy ranged weapons normally use a Shoot (Double) action.
However, there is also the interaction between Overwatch and Fast Shot. Since Fast Shot turns Shoot (Basic) into Shoot (Simple), does it mean that the fighter can't fire overwatch anymore? That would be ridiculous.

I think the simple solution is to consider that, whenever they say "Shoot (Basic) action", what they really mean is "Shoot action". If a skill disallows for the use of Unwieldy ranged weapons, it will explicitly say so, as is the case for Fast Shot and Hip Shooting.
